< prev index next >
make/CompileInterimLangtools.gmk
Print this page
@@ -43,20 +43,20 @@
$$(eval $$(call SetupJavaCompilation,BUILD_INTERIM_$(strip $1), \
SETUP := BOOT_JAVAC, \
DISABLE_SJAVAC := true, \
SRC := $(TOPDIR)/src/$(strip $1)/share/classes \
$$(wildcard $(SUPPORT_OUTPUTDIR)/gensrc/$(strip $1)), \
- EXCLUDES := sun com/sun/tools/jdeps com/sun/tools/javap \
- com/sun/tools/jdeprscan, \
- EXCLUDE_FILES := module-info.java JavacToolProvider.java \
- JavadocToolProvider.java Standard.java, \
+ EXCLUDES := com/sun/tools/jdeprscan, \
+ EXCLUDE_FILES := Standard.java, \
COPY := .gif .png .xml .css .js javax.tools.JavaCompilerTool, \
BIN := $(BUILDTOOLS_OUTPUTDIR)/override_modules/$(strip $1), \
- ADD_JAVAC_FLAGS := -Xbootclasspath/p:$$(call PathList, \
- $$(foreach m, $2, $(BUILDTOOLS_OUTPUTDIR)/override_modules/$$m)), \
+ ADD_JAVAC_FLAGS := --upgrade-module-path $(BUILDTOOLS_OUTPUTDIR)/override_modules, \
))
+#$$(foreach m, $$2, \
+ --patch-module $$m=$(BUILDTOOLS_OUTPUTDIR)/override_modules/$$m), \
+
$$(BUILD_INTERIM_$(strip $1)): $$(foreach m, $2, $$(BUILD_INTERIM_$(strip $$m)))
TARGETS += $$(BUILD_INTERIM_$(strip $1))
endef
< prev index next >